in.As a Manufacturing Electrical Engineer, you will develop and
implement new and improved methods for manufacturing, assembly, and
testing of harsh environment sensors used in nuclear reactors,
radiation monitoring, oil & gas exploration, and natural gas
turbines. Your responsibilities will span from supporting daily
production needs to larger projects that make a positive impact on
quality and customer satisfaction.As a Manufacturing Electrical
Engineer, you will be responsible for:Driving improvements to
process capability and documentation, and subsequent training of
othersLeading improvements in test setups, test automation, and
trend monitoringOwning new equipment/upgrades from purchase through
installationLeading Health, Safety & Environmental (HSE)
projectsDeveloping and maintaining manufacturing methods and
process routingsDesigning and building/procuring necessary tooling,
fixturing, and poka-yoke devicesContributing to NPI (New Product
Introduction) programs throughout concept, prototype, pilot,
validation, and manufacturing implementation stage gatesFuel your
passionRequired Qualifications:Have a Bachelor's degree in
Electrical Engineering from an accredited universityHave 5 years
minimum experiencePreferred Qualifications:Proven experience in
problem-solving and failure analysisStrong service orientation to
the production floor and customers alikeDemonstrable successes in a
high quality and regulatory environmentAbility to coordinate
several projects concurrentlyExperience with debugging,
troubleshooting, and testing both electrical and mechanical
systemsLabVIEW Core 1 and Core 2, Visual Basic, MS
AccessFamiliarity with nuclear instrumentation and measurements a
plusFamiliarity with electronics for use in extreme temperature,
shock and vibration environments is desirableExperience with IPC
J-STD-001 & IPC-A-610SOLIDWORKS experience a plusSAP
